7-Day Family-Friendly Itinerary in Uttarakhand

Thursday, August 10: Nainital

Start your trip by visiting the beautiful hill station of Nainital. In the morning, take a boat ride on Naini Lake and enjoy the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, explore the bustling Mall Road, known for its shops and restaurants. As the evening sets in, visit the Naina Devi Temple and enjoy the stunning sunset views from Naini Peak.

  • Naini Lake: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Mall Road: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Naina Devi Temple: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Naini Peak: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
Restaurants
  • Breakfast: Sakley's The Mountain Cafe - Enjoy a hearty breakfast at Sakley's The Mountain Cafe, known for its cozy ambiance and delicious food. Average cost for a meal is about 400 INR per person.
  • Lunch: Embassy Restaurant - Grab a bite at Embassy Restaurant, a popular eatery offering a wide variety of cuisines. Average cost for a meal is about 300 INR per person.
  • Dinner: Machan Restaurant - Indulge in a sumptuous dinner at Machan Restaurant, known for its rustic decor and mouthwatering dishes. Average cost for a meal is about 600 INR per person.
Friday, August 11: Jim Corbett National Park

Embark on an exciting wildlife adventure at Jim Corbett National Park. In the morning, take a jeep safari to spot tigers and other wildlife species. In the afternoon, visit the Corbett Museum to learn about the park's history. As the evening sets in, enjoy a nature walk along the Kosi River.

  • Jeep Safari: Cost - INR 4,000 per vehicle, Time Spent - 4-5 hours
  • Corbett Museum: Cost - INR 50 per person,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Nature Walk: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Saturday, August 12: Rishikesh

Explore the spiritual town of Rishikesh, known as the Yoga Capital of the World. In the morning, attend a yoga session on the banks of the Ganges River.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Laxman Jhula and Ram Jhula suspension bridges. As the evening sets in, witness the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ti ceremony at Triveni Ghat.

  • Yoga Session: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Laxman Jhula and Ram Jhula: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Ganga Aarti at Triveni Ghat: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
Sunday, August 13: Mussoorie

Head to the enchanting hill station of Mussoorie. In the morning, take a cable car ride to Gun Hill and enjoy panoramic views of the Himalayas.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Mall Road and visit the famous Kempty Falls. As the evening sets in, indulge in local delicacies at the bustling Landour Bazaar.

  • Cable Car Ride: Cost - INR 75 per person,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Mall Road: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Kempty Falls: Cost - INR 50 per person,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Landour Bazaar: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
Monday, August 14: Haridwar

Visit the holy city of Haridwar, known for its religious significance. In the morning, take a dip in the sacred Ganges River at Har Ki Pauri Ghat. In the afternoon, explore the ancient temples, including Mansa Devi Temple and Chandi Devi Temple. As the evening sets in, witness the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ti at Har Ki Pauri Ghat.

  • Har Ki Pauri Ghat: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Mansa Devi Temple: Cost - INR 200 per person (cable car ride),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Chandi Devi Temple: Cost - INR 200 per person (cable car ride),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Ganga Aarti at Har Ki Pauri Ghat: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
Tuesday, August 15: Auli

Experience the beauty of Auli, a popular skiing destination. In the morning, take a cable car ride to Auli from Joshimath and enjoy breathtaking views of the snow-capped Himalayas. In the afternoon, indulge in skiing and other snow activities. As the evening sets in, relax and soak in the serene atmosphere of Auli.

  • Cable Car Ride: Cost - INR 750 per person (round trip),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Skiing and Snow Activities: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 4-5 hours
Wednesday, August 16: Almora

Explore the picturesque town of Almora. In the morning, visit the ancient Jageshwar Temple complex and admire its intricate architecture.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ant local markets and indulge in shopping for unique handicrafts. As the evening sets in, enjoy a peaceful sunset at Bright End Corner.

  • Jageshwar Temple: Cost - INR 50 per person,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Shopping at Local Markets: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Bright End Corner: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ions in Uttarakhand, consider visiting Binsar Wildlife Sanctuary, where you can spot a variety of wildlife and enjoy panoramic views of the Himalayas. Another hidden gem is the peaceful village of Chopta, known as the "Mini Switzerland of India," offering breathtaking views and trekking opportunities for the whole family.
